Who can use the AIA Life Planner mobile application?
- The AIA Life Planner is intended to be used only by AIA Agents. You will need to use your existing Agent ID and ALPP password to login to the app. You can further setup the app to login via biometric (fingerprint) and/or 6 digit secure PIN as a login shortcut. When you are logging in for the first time on a new device, we will send an OTP on your registered mobile number for security and authentication. Please ensure that your current mobile (Hand Phone) number is updated on ALPP.

What is the 6 digit verification code?
- The 6 digit verification code or the OTP (One Time Password) is sent to your registered mobile number (as updated by you in ALPP) to bind your mobile phone with your login ID. This is done for security purposes.

What is the difference between 6 digit verification code (OTP) and 6 digit PIN code.
- The 6 digit verification code or the OTP (One Time Password) is sent to your registered mobile number (as updated by you in ALPP) to bind your mobile phone with your login ID. This is done for security purposes. The 6 digit PIN code is your personal access code setup and know only to you and is intended to be used in lieu of the password. This feature has been added to the app to make the login process more convenient.

I have setup my 6 digit PIN code/Biometric access. Can I now use the same to login to ALPP
- No, the login shortcut via the 6 Digit Secure PIN Code and Biometric validation is only valid for the specific mobile device on which you have installed and setup the app. These credentials cannot be sued on any other device or app.
-
What is the different between my ALPP’s password and the 6 digit PIN code?
- The 6 digit PIN code is setup on the mobile device on which you have logged in to the App. It is your personal access code setup and know only to you and is intended to be used in lieu of the password. This feature has been added to the app to make the login process more convenient. You cannot use the 6 digit PIN to login to ALPP. If you change your device, you will be asked to re-register on the app and will have the option to setup an new 6 digit pin code.

I have 2 mobile phones, Can I use the app on both phones?
- No, you can only login to the AIA Life planner app on one device at a time. If you choose to install and setup the app on a 2nd device, your first device will automatically be deregistered. Please keep in mind that the OTP password to setup the app on the new device will only be sent on your phone number registered with AIA.
-
What happens if I forgot my 6 digit PIN code?
- You can click the ‘Forgot PIN’ link on the login screen to reset your pin and follow the instructions on the screen. You will be sent an OTP on the mobile number registered with AIA to be able to successfully complete the process

My fellow colleague who is also an AIA agent is asking to borrow my phone to login to the Life Planner App. What should I do? Will he be able to see my client details?
- We do not recommend that you share your mobile phone with your fellow colleagues. If your colleague tries to login to the app using his/her ALPP login credentials, your device will automatically be deregistered - an OTP will be sent only to the registered mobile number of your colleague for them to be able to login to the app and when you try to login to the app again on the same device, you will have to repeat the whole setup process again (OTP, Setup Biometric and PIN).
- Your client data will always be safe and will not be exposed to anyone else unless you yourself share your login ID/password/PIN details with anyone.

Why I don’t receive any notifications?
- The Life Planner App has a facility to update you with important details about your clients and their applications/policies via push notifications. If you are not receiving notifications, then you could have accidentally disabled the notifications for the Life Planner App on your device. Please check your device settings and enable push notifications for the Life planner app
